I was planning to host the one in Sussex in August again but have also gotten feedback that late August is not ideal for the guys that are just getting into it since there are lead times to buy once you decide with some of the manufacturers. Saddle lead times are pretty short these days but not always the case with sticks and stands. @TexaninSconny remind me, where are you located? I am open to a change of scenery and am willing to help organize since I’ve been through the rodeo a few times.

a little more on my past meetups. I held them in partnership with Sherwood Forest Bowmen in Sussex the weekend of their annual Bowhunters warmup open house and 3D shoot. The nice thing about that setup is they take care of food, beverages and 3D course and we just show up and hang out, show off our gear and then if people want, they can head out and shoot the 3D course / eat / drink. I didn’t charge anything for the meetup itself. As a bonus, people coming for the open house had an opportunity to check out saddles before or after shooting the 3D course. Last year, @DanO from EWO was there and Rob and Rick from Hunting Beast Gear were there. Both supported with giveaway items. Chad and Jerry from CRUZR came up one year and Chad has continued supporting with saddle and a seeker giveaways. Mark Dohring has also been a regular and supportive with giveaway Items.

It really is a fun time. We have had around 25 people each year so pretty much every commercial saddle, stick and platform out there have been represented at some point.
 
The Sherwood Forest Bowhunters warmup is Aug 26-28 this year so that would put my meetup on Aug 27 if I host this year.
